How it's calculated

RCC slab: concrete volume is area × thickness; that's scaled by 1.54 and split by the grade ratio into cement, sand and aggregate, and reinforcement is estimated at your kg-per-m³ figure (about 80 kg/m³ is typical for a house slab). Sheets: roof area plus overlap allowance, divided by the area of one sheet.

Steel in a slab varies with span and design — 80 kg/m³ is a planning figure, not a substitute for a bar-bending schedule. Follow your engineer's drawing.

Frequently asked questions

Typical slab thickness?
100–150 mm for houses; 125 mm is common. Your engineer sets it from the span.
How much steel in a slab?
Roughly 80 kg per m³ of slab concrete as a planning figure; the actual comes from the structural design.
What overlap for sheets?
Allow about 10–15% for side and end laps; steeper or windier roofs need more.
